Men's Tennis Defeats Southern Maine, 8-1

Bridgewater, Mass. -- In Little East Conference men's tennis action, the Bridgewater State College Bears defeated the University of Southern Maine, 8-1, this afternoon from the Dr. Henry Rosen Memorial Tennis Courts in Bridgewater.

The Bears (3-5, 1-3 LEC) captured all three doubles matches and five of the six singles matches to come away with the win.

Junior co-captain Matt Charest (Somerset, MA) and senior co-captain Barry Gorman (Hopedale, Ma) led the Bears to the big conference win as they snapped a three-game losing streak.

Charest battled to a three set win at first flight singles as he came back from a set down to win 4-6, 6-0, 10-7.  He also teamed with junior Giovanni Cuscina (Mansfield, MA) for an 8-5 victory at first doubles.

Gorman won his eighth straight singles match as he remains undefeated in singles play this season.  Competing at second singles, Gorman also won a tough three set match, 7-5, 4-6, 11-9.  He teamed up with junior Brendon Barbo (Yarmouthport, MA) for an 8-3 victory at second flight doubles.

Bridgewater State hosts Clark University tomorrow at 3:30.  Southern Maine (4-5, 3-3 LEC) travels to Colby College on Thursday for a 5 PM match with the White Mules.
